#298c26 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#298c26 is composed of 16.1% red, 54.9% green and 14.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 72.9%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 118.2 degrees, a saturation of 57.3% and a lightness of 34.9%. #298c26 color hex could be obtained by blending #52ff4c with #001900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

● #298c26 color description : Dark lime green.
#298c26 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#298c26 has RGB values of R:41, G:140, B:38 and CMYK values of C:0.71, M:0, Y:0.73,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 2722854.

Shades and Tints of #298c26
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f1fbf1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#298c26
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#565c56 is the less saturated color, while #09ae04 is the most saturated one.
